Low voltage grid-connected photovoltaic system laboratory at the Universidad Distrital Francisco José de Caldas
This work aims to explain the measurement that was made of a PV grid connected system, which was a project implemented at “Universidad Distrital Francisco Jose de Caldas” in Bogotá D.C., consisting of two photovoltaic solar modules of 120 watts peak used as a generator, grid-connected three-phase low voltage by an inverter of 190 watts of nominal power by an inverter of 190 watts of nominal power. For the measurement of electrical energy has two four-wire three phase electronic meters, the first at the inverter output to record the energy generated by the generator, and the second for interaction between the grid and the load, in addition to therefore has a system of protection provided to respond to any system failure and a bank ready for testing loads and for analyzing energy flows in the system.
